Key DifferencesThe driver size differs between the two (10 mm vs 12.2 mm), which can influence sound depth, bass response, and overall audio clarity. boAt Rockerz 195 Pro and Philips TAN1207BK offer different noise cancellation capabilities (ENx vs Environmental Noise Cancelling), which can impact how effectively they block external noise. Impedance levels vary (16 ohm vs 32 Ohms), which can affect compatibility and audio output when used with different devices. If you're comparing boAt Rockerz 195 Pro and Philips TAN1207BK, both models offer a strong combination of sound performance, comfort, and modern wireless features. Both models support modern Bluetooth connectivity, ensuring stable wireless performance with compatible devices. There is a noticeable difference in weight (50 Gm vs 26 GM), which may affect comfort during extended use. The frequency response differs (20 Hz - 20000 Hz vs 20Hz - 20KHz), which can influence how well the headphones reproduce lows, mids, and highs. Overall, both headphones are feature-rich and cater to users looking for a combination of sound quality, comfort, and wireless convenience. Battery life varies between the two (20 Hours vs 15 Hours), which affects how long you can use them on a single charge. Verdict: Both headphones offer strong performance, and the right choice depends on your priorities such as battery life, comfort, and noise cancellation. Top Differences
